Can hand sanitizer kill the herpes simplex-1 virus when applied to hands or inanimate objects that are contaminated with it. can disinfectant sprays?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Julie Abbott answered

Specializes in Preventive Medicine

It helps ....: While anti-bacterial hand sanitizer doesn't kill viruses, using it will help protect you from becoming infected. Alcohol based products may be especially helpful as alcohol can destabilize a viral cell membrane. Disinfectant sprays would have limited use for this purpose. Good wishes:)
